Editor's Review ★★★★☆

AudioBook Atlas

Christina Moore delivers a performance that perfectly matches the narrative’s tone, bringing the characters to life with nuance and emotion. Her portrayal of Peg Toland is particularly impressive, capturing both her curiosity and her growing awareness of the island's complexities. The storytelling pace is impeccable; it balances detailed descriptions of the island’s geography with the escalating tensions between Peg’s family and the locals. However, some sections might feel slightly rushed, perhaps due to the tight runtime, which occasionally skimps on deeper character development. Despite this minor critique, 'Sweet Friday Island' remains a captivating listen for anyone intrigued by stories that intertwine adventure with cultural discovery.
